Location
4 Spa Resort Hotel is conveniently located just 6 km from Stazione Catania Borgo and 15 km from Fontanarossa Airport. The resort's proximity to landmarks such as Ognina and Faro Li Cuti enhances the guest experience, allowing for easy access to both cultural attractions and natural beauty. A strategic position provides guests with opportunities to explore the stunning beaches and historical sites of Sicily.

Leisure & Business
The resort features an extensive wellness center, including a large spa and several swimming pools. Guests can engage in various recreational activities such as yoga, Pilates, and aquatic programs tailored for wellness. The wellness center provides a holistic approach, combining treatments for beauty and relaxation in modern facilities.
